Software streamlines development of high-power LED systems
Thermal management is critically important in any solidstate
lighting system, as the junction temperature affects
both LED light output and lifetime. QLed is a powerful
simulation and optimisation software package that
allows engineers to perform real-time thermal design of
electronic systems that use LUXEON® high-power LEDs. It
allows users to simulate the thermal characteristics of
their mechanical designs, thus minimising the number of
design cycles, reducing development costs, and
decreasing time to market.
|
|
QLed has been designed with ease-of-use in mind, with
step-by-step design wizards and built-in models of
LUXEON high-power LEDs. A library has been included to
allow for the storing, sharing, and re-use of components,
assemblies and entire models. QLed is also
computationally inexpensive and fast; most simulations
take only a few minutes to run. Furthermore, QLed design
and analysis is not limited to mechanical fixtures, but can
also be run on systems with multiple components, such
as heat sinks, fans and openings.
